Several new shopping and grocery options are coming to the Lake Houston area as commercial developers venture farther north and south of Deerbrook Mall on FM 1960.
Four large-scale retail-anchored developments are under construction as developers target the area’s rapid population growth, relatively uncongested traffic arteries and a high availability of undeveloped land, said Charlie Dromgoole, senior vice president of economic development for the Lake Houston Area Chamber of Commerce.
“Retail follows rooftops,” Dromgoole said. “It’s almost a chain reaction. You’ve got good schools, you’ve got lots of land and you’ve got transportation. It all starts flowing when the housing starts flowing, and the retail follows.”
